.ant-table-tbody .ant-table-row td[data-v-19304bae]{padding-top:10px;padding-bottom:10px}#components-layout-demo-custom-trigger .trigger[data-v-19304bae]{font-size:18px;line-height:64px;padding:0 24px;cursor:pointer;transition:color .3s}.acceptance-form-container[data-v-733d71bd]{padding:12px}.acceptance-form-container .form-title[data-v-733d71bd]{text-align:center;margin-bottom:24px;font-weight:700;font-size:20px}.acceptance-form-container .acceptance-table[data-v-733d71bd]{width:100%;border-collapse:collapse;margin-bottom:20px}.acceptance-form-container .acceptance-table td[data-v-733d71bd]{border:1px solid #d9d9d9;padding:8px}.acceptance-form-container .acceptance-table .label-cell[data-v-733d71bd]{width:15%;background-color:#f5f5f5;text-align:right;font-weight:700}.acceptance-form-container .acceptance-table .content-cell[data-v-733d71bd]{width:35%}.acceptance-form-container .acceptance-table .highlight-row[data-v-733d71bd]{background-color:#fffbe6}.acceptance-form-container .acceptance-table .highlight-row .label-cell[data-v-733d71bd]{background-color:#fff7cc}.acceptance-form-container .section-title[data-v-733d71bd]{font-weight:700;margin:15px 0 8px 0}.acceptance-form-container .text-area-container[data-v-733d71bd]{border:1px solid #d9d9d9;padding:8px;background-color:#fff}.acceptance-form-container .acceptance-criteria[data-v-733d71bd]{border:1px solid #d9d9d9;padding:12px;background-color:#fff}.acceptance-form-container .acceptance-criteria .ant-checkbox-wrapper[data-v-733d71bd]{display:block;margin:8px 0}.acceptance-form-container .conclusion-section[data-v-733d71bd]{margin:15px 0}.acceptance-form-container .conclusion-section .conclusion-options[data-v-733d71bd]{border:1px solid #d9d9d9;padding:12px;background-color:#fff}.acceptance-form-container .signature-area[data-v-733d71bd]{border:1px solid #d9d9d9;padding:12px;background-color:#fff;margin-bottom:15px}.acceptance-form-container .signature-table[data-v-733d71bd]{width:100%;border-collapse:collapse;margin-top:20px}.acceptance-form-container .signature-table .signature-cell[data-v-733d71bd]{border:1px solid #d9d9d9;padding:8px;text-align:center;width:25%}.acceptance-form-container .param-row[data-v-733d71bd]{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.acceptance-form-container .param-row .param-label[data-v-733d71bd]{font-weight:700;margin-right:8px}.acceptance-form-container[data-v-7de1e79e]{padding:12px}.acceptance-form-container .form-title[data-v-7de1e79e]{text-align:center;margin-bottom:24px;font-weight:700;font-size:20px}.acceptance-form-container .asset-number-row[data-v-7de1e79e]{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;margin-bottom:15px}.acceptance-form-container .asset-number-row .asset-number-label[data-v-7de1e79e]{font-weight:700}.acceptance-form-container .asset-number-row .asset-number-value[data-v-7de1e79e]{-ms-flex:1;flex:1;margin:0 10px}.acceptance-form-container .acceptance-table[data-v-7de1e79e],.acceptance-form-container .signature-table[data-v-7de1e79e]{width:100%;border-collapse:collapse;margin-bottom:20px}.acceptance-form-container .acceptance-table td[data-v-7de1e79e],.acceptance-form-container .signature-table td[data-v-7de1e79e]{border:1px solid #d9d9d9;padding:8px}.acceptance-form-container .acceptance-table .label-cell[data-v-7de1e79e],.acceptance-form-container .signature-table .label-cell[data-v-7de1e79e]{width:15%;background-color:#f5f5f5;text-align:right;font-weight:700}.acceptance-form-container .acceptance-table .content-cell[data-v-7de1e79e],.acceptance-form-container .signature-table .content-cell[data-v-7de1e79e]{width:35%}.acceptance-form-container .section-title[data-v-7de1e79e]{font-weight:700;margin:15px 0 8px 0}.acceptance-form-container .text-area-container[data-v-7de1e79e]{border:1px solid #d9d9d9;padding:8px;background-color:#fff}.acceptance-form-container .accessories-table[data-v-7de1e79e]{width:100%;border-collapse:collapse;margin-bottom:10px}.acceptance-form-container .accessories-table td[data-v-7de1e79e],.acceptance-form-container .accessories-table th[data-v-7de1e79e]{border:1px solid #d9d9d9;padding:8px;text-align:center}.acceptance-form-container .accessories-table th[data-v-7de1e79e]{background-color:#f5f5f5;font-weight:700}.acceptance-form-container .add-accessory-btn[data-v-7de1e79e]{margin-bottom:20px}.acceptance-form-container .documents-container[data-v-7de1e79e]{border:1px solid #d9d9d9;padding:12px;background-color:#fff;margin-bottom:20px}.acceptance-form-container .documents-container .document-row[data-v-7de1e79e]{display:-ms-flexbox;display:flex;margin-bottom:10px}.acceptance-form-container .documents-container .document-row .ant-checkbox-wrapper[data-v-7de1e79e]{-ms-flex:1;flex:1;margin-right:20px}.acceptance-form-container .warranty-period[data-v-7de1e79e]{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.acceptance-form-container .warranty-period .date-separator[data-v-7de1e79e]{margin:0 10px}.fixed-width-table .ant-table-table[data-v-7cf60e26]{table-layout:fixed!important}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26],.fixed-width-table .ant-table-thead>tr>th[data-v-7cf60e26]{white-space:nowrap;overflow:hidden;text-overflow:ellipsis;word-break:break-all}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26]{max-width:0}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26]:nth-child(7),.fixed-width-table .ant-table-thead>tr>th[data-v-7cf60e26]:nth-child(7){width:120px!important;min-width:120px!important;max-width:120px!important}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26]:nth-child(8),.fixed-width-table .ant-table-thead>tr>th[data-v-7cf60e26]:nth-child(8){width:150px!important;min-width:150px!important;max-width:150px!important}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26]:nth-child(9),.fixed-width-table .ant-table-thead>tr>th[data-v-7cf60e26]:nth-child(9){width:130px!important;min-width:130px!important;max-width:130px!important}.fixed-width-table .ant-table-tbody>tr>td[data-v-7cf60e26]:nth-child(10),.fixed-width-table .ant-table-thead>tr>th[data-v-7cf60e26]:nth-child(10){width:150px!important;min-width:150px!important;max-width:150px!important}.timeline-wrap[data-v-880dbfac]{padding:20px}.timeline-wrap .timeline-header[data-v-880dbfac]{padding-bottom:16px;margin-bottom:20px;border-bottom:1px solid #e8e8e8}.timeline-wrap .timeline-header span[data-v-880dbfac]{font-size:18px;font-weight:700;color:#333}.timeline-wrap .timeline-container[data-v-880dbfac]{position:relative}.timeline-wrap .timeline-container[data-v-880dbfac]:before{content:"";position:absolute;top:0;left:120px;height:100%;width:2px;background-color:#1890ff}.timeline-wrap .timeline-item[data-v-880dbfac]{position:relative;display:-ms-flexbox;display:flex;margin-bottom:30px}.timeline-wrap .timeline-item[data-v-880dbfac]:last-child{margin-bottom:0}.timeline-wrap .timeline-item[data-v-880dbfac]:before{content:"";position:absolute;left:120px;top:15px;width:12px;height:12px;border-radius:50%;background-color:#fff;border:2px solid #1890ff;transform:translateX(-50%);z-index:1}.timeline-wrap .timeline-item .timeline-item-time[data-v-880dbfac]{width:100px;padding-right:20px;text-align:right;-ms-flex-negative:0;flex-shrink:0}.timeline-wrap .timeline-item .timeline-item-time .time-date[data-v-880dbfac]{font-weight:700;color:#333;font-size:14px}.timeline-wrap .timeline-item .timeline-item-time .time-hour[data-v-880dbfac]{color:#999;font-size:12px;margin-top:4px}.timeline-wrap .timeline-item .timeline-item-content[data-v-880dbfac]{-ms-flex:1;flex:1;margin-left:40px;background-color:#f5f5f5;padding:16px;border-radius:4px;box-shadow:0 2px 8px rgba(0,0,0,.09)}.timeline-wrap .timeline-item .timeline-item-content[data-v-880dbfac]:hover{background-color:#e6f7ff}.timeline-wrap .timeline-item .timeline-item-content .content-title[data-v-880dbfac]{font-size:16px;font-weight:700;color:#333;margin-bottom:8px}.timeline-wrap .timeline-item .timeline-item-content .content-detail[data-v-880dbfac]{font-size:14px;color:#666;line-height:1.5;margin-bottom:12px;white-space:pre-line}.timeline-wrap .timeline-item .timeline-item-content .content-images[data-v-880dbfac]{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in:0 -5px 12px}.timeline-wrap .timeline-item .timeline-item-content .content-images .image-wrapper[data-v-880dbfac]{width:120px;height:120px;margin:5px;overflow:hidden;border-radius:4px;cursor:pointer}.timeline-wrap .timeline-item .timeline-item-content .content-images .image-wrapper img[data-v-880dbfac]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:transform .3s}.timeline-wrap .timeline-item .timeline-item-content .content-images .image-wrapper img[data-v-880dbfac]:hover{transform:scale(1.05)}.timeline-wrap .timeline-item .timeline-item-content .content-tags[data-v-880dbfac]{margin-top:8px}.timeline-wrap .timeline-item .timeline-item-content .content-tags .ant-tag[data-v-880dbfac]{margin-right:8px;margin-bottom:8px}.timeline-wrap .timeline-item .timeline-item-content .image-gallery[data-v-880dbfac]{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:4px}.timeline-wrap .timeline-item .timeline-item-content .image-gallery .image-item[data-v-880dbfac]{width:60px;height:60px;overflow:hidden;border-radius:4px;cursor:pointer;border:1px solid #d9d9d9}.timeline-wrap .timeline-item .timeline-item-content .image-gallery .image-item img[data-v-880dbfac]{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:transform .2s}.timeline-wrap .timeline-item .timeline-item-content .image-gallery .image-item img[data-v-880dbfac]:hover{transform:scale(1.1)}.device-detail-card[data-v-dd8ce5aa]{margin-bottom:24px}.device-detail-card .device-header[data-v-dd8ce5aa]{background-color:#f5f5f5;padding:16px;border-radius:4px;margin-bottom:24px}.device-detail-card .detail-collapse[data-v-dd8ce5aa]{margin:16px 0 24px}.device-detail-card .detail-collapse[data-v-dd8ce5aa] .ant-collapse-header{font-weight:700;color:rgba(0,0,0,.85)}.device-detail-card .chart-row[data-v-dd8ce5aa]{margin-bottom:24px}.device-detail-card[data-v-dd8ce5aa] .ant-descriptions-item-label{width:120px;font-weight:500}.device-detail-card[data-v-dd8ce5aa] .ant-tabs-bar{margin-bottom:16px}.device-detail-card[data-v-dd8ce5aa] .ant-divider-inner-text{font-weight:700;font-size:16px}.expand-detail-table[data-v-8066cb86]{margin-top:16px}.tab-content[data-v-8066cb86]{padding:8px 0}.initial-import-modal[data-v-8066cb86]{margin-bottom:24px}.initial-import-header[data-v-8066cb86]{display:-ms-flexbox;display:flex;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;margin-bottom:16px}.upload-tip[data-v-8066cb86]{color:rgba(0,0,0,.45)}.upload-area[data-v-8066cb86]{border:2px dashed #d9d9d9;border-radius:4px;background-color:#fafafa;text-align:center;padding:32px;cursor:pointer;transition:border-color .3s;margin-bottom:16px}.upload-area.is-dragover[data-v-8066cb86]{border-color:#1890ff;background-color:#e6f7ff}.upload-area p[data-v-8066cb86]{margin:8px 0 0;color:rgba(0,0,0,.65)}.data-preview[data-v-8066cb86]{margin-top:24px}.preview-header[data-v-8066cb86]{display:-ms-flexbox;display:flex;-ms-flex-pack:justify;justify-content:space-between;-ms-flex-align:center;align-items:center;margin-bottom:8px}.initial-import-footer[data-v-8066cb86]{text-align:right;margin-top:24px}